Seasonal Increase in Bricks Rates in Pakistan – 15th May 2026

Bricks are one of the most important materials in the construction industry of Pakistan. Every year, the market experiences a noticeable seasonal increase in brick prices, especially during the summer construction season. In May 2026, brick rates across major cities including Lahore, Islamabad, Rawalpindi, Faisalabad, Multan, and Karachi have again shown an upward trend due to increasing construction activity, fuel costs, labor expenses, and transportation charges.

According to recent market updates, Awwal (first-class) bricks in Pakistan are currently ranging between PKR 16,000 to PKR 19,000 per 1,000 bricks depending on the city and kiln quality.

Why Brick Rates Increase Seasonally in Pakistan

Seasonal fluctuations in brick prices are very common in Pakistan’s construction market. The main reasons behind the increase in brick rates during the summer season are:

1. Peak Construction Season

From March to October, construction work increases rapidly across Pakistan due to favorable weather conditions. Builders, contractors, and homeowners prefer completing grey structure work before the monsoon season. This higher demand directly affects brick supply and prices.

Housing societies in Islamabad, Rawalpindi, Lahore, and other urban areas are currently witnessing rapid development, which has significantly increased the demand for quality bricks.

2. Increase in Fuel and Coal Prices

Brick kilns in Pakistan heavily depend on coal and fuel for brick manufacturing. In 2026, rising fuel prices have increased kiln operating costs. Transportation charges for delivering bricks from kilns to construction sites have also increased considerably.

Higher diesel prices are directly impacting:

  • Brick manufacturing cost
  • Delivery charges
  • Labor transportation
  • Loading and unloading expenses

3. Labor Shortage During Summer

During the peak construction season, skilled labor becomes expensive due to high demand. Kiln owners increase wages for workers involved in:

  • Clay preparation
  • Brick molding
  • Kiln firing
  • Loading operations

This additional labor expense ultimately affects market rates.

4. High Demand for Awwal Bricks

Most homeowners and contractors prefer Awwal bricks for residential and commercial projects because of their strength and durability. As demand for first-class bricks rises, kiln owners increase prices accordingly.

Current market estimates in May 2026 show:

Brick TypeAverage Rate Per 1,000 Bricks
Awwal BricksPKR 16,000 – 19,000
Doem BricksPKR 13,000 – 15,000
Khangar BricksPKR 10,000 – 12,000

City-Wise Seasonal Brick Rates in Pakistan – May 2026

Lahore

Lahore continues to have one of the highest brick demands due to ongoing residential and commercial projects. Awwal brick rates in Lahore are currently touching PKR 18,000 to PKR 19,000 per 1,000 bricks in many areas.

Islamabad & Rawalpindi

Construction activity in CDA sectors and nearby housing societies has pushed brick prices higher. Transportation from kilns around Taxila and surrounding areas also adds to the final cost.

Karachi

Karachi’s market remains comparatively expensive because of transportation costs and higher labor rates. Premium-quality bricks are witnessing consistent price increases.

Faisalabad & Multan

Southern Punjab regions are also seeing seasonal price jumps due to rapid housing development and increased kiln demand.

Impact of Rising Brick Prices on Construction Cost

Brickwork forms a major portion of grey structure construction. Even a small increase in brick rates can significantly affect the total project budget.

For example:

  • A standard 5 marla house may require around 80,000 to 90,000 bricks.
  • If brick prices increase by PKR 1,000 per 1,000 bricks, the total project cost may increase by PKR 80,000 to 90,000.

This is why many builders prefer purchasing bricks in advance before the peak season starts.

Will Brick Prices Increase Further in 2026?

Market experts believe brick rates may continue increasing during the coming months because of:

  • Rising fuel prices
  • Increased transportation costs
  • High construction demand
  • Inflation in building materials
  • Energy tariff increases

Construction material prices in Pakistan have generally remained unstable throughout 2026.

Best Brick Type for House Construction

For residential construction in Pakistan, Awwal bricks remain the preferred option because they provide:

  • Better compressive strength
  • Proper shape and size
  • Lower water absorption
  • Improved wall finishing
  • Long-term durability

Although they are more expensive than Doem or Khangar bricks, they provide better structural performance for homes and commercial buildings.
